The disclosure concerns a protective shroud (10) for protecting the leading edge of a blade of a digging implement such as a front end loader, an excavator, or similar vehicle. The shroud (10) includes a slot (12) into which the leading edge of the loader or excavator blade is received. A bolt cavity (14) is designed to receive an support a horizontal bolt (18) such that thread (19) of the bolt can pass through an aperture (24) extending horizontally through a boss (22) formed in the blade to receive a nut (26). Tightening of the nut (26) will draw the shroud (10) toward the boss (22) such that the slot (12) bears onto the blade.
